This is the problem with taxonomies. Now we are starting to create
structure. I know at least on diver who always tracks the body of water. I
know another one who for reasons I cannot explain tracks the county.

I don't want to try to create a taxonomy that makes every one happy. I
don't want to have to think about the data structure below that. I don't want to think about the insanity of trying to import from different data
formats.

How about a hierarchical dive site structure? Users that don't care about any kind of structure, can just use a flat list. Users that prefer some kind of taxonomy are free to create the one they like (e.g. Country/State/Place, Country/Place, Water Body/Place, etc are all possible).

As far as subsurface is concerned, there would still be no real structure involved (except for the child/parent relationship of course). The actual structure and how to use it, is entirely up to the user.

This idea is of course not mutually exclusive with tags!
